'50 pairs from 50 shops' - Moon Light Llamas

This weeks feature is brought to you by special guest... Tilly the Llama ;)


She's the lovely gal striking a pose while standing... isn't she just a doll?

Jan of Moon Light Llamas (Tilly's Llama Mama) sent me the cutest little hank specially hand spun (and hand dyed) from Tilly's fleece just for Hooking :D



The yarn is 100% Llama in two ply sport-ish weight yarn form and is incredibly smooshy soft :D The pretty true blue colorway with hints of fuchsia and purple complement the soft halo of the yarn's natural characteristics very nicely.

I'm using a size "G" hook for the shoes pictured above which are currently a "WIP" with finishing up planned for tomorrow night.

Tilly was the first llama born on Jan's farm (14 years ago) and provides fiber for Jan's own brand of uber cute bunny baby booties. Jan's shop also features hand made felted hats, teddy bears, felting kits and supplies.

Her fiber skills are top notch and I feel very honored (as I do with all my donors) to receive one of her hand made endeavors for use in the Hooking for Charity fund raiser.

'50 pairs from 50 shops' - Yarn Hollow

Y is for Yummy Variety :D

Need to add a little variety to your stash? Check out Yarn Hollow's Shop...

Bulky, super bulky, boulce, mohair, alpaca, tussah silk, yarns, rovings and more all hand dyed using fiber reactive dyes in flowing sophisticated shades.

Rita of Yarn Hollow has loaded up her shop with large quantity runs (around 8 oz. each) of her warm toned yarns so there's plenty of each dye lot for your larger projects.

So far I've worked my way through about 1/3 of the box she sent to Hooking (more finished items coming in May). The finished shoes, created from some fabulous single ply, are now also available for purchase via the etsy shop http://mysweetiepeas.etsy.com

"Crayon" features bright and cheery peachy gold, perwinkle, magenta, pink and muted minty green swirled together in short burst of color while the "Seattle" colorway (first pair) is more subtle with sea tones of barely there green and a range of soft pretty blues.

The unique texture of the single ply matched up perfectly to each colorway producing cute and super cozy baby shoes :D
